Indianapolis Monthly Internship Opportunities

Indianapolis Monthly offers college students and graduates three types of unpaid internships: editorial, art and promotions/sales. Internships are offered in the spring and fall semesters, winter academic term (January) and summer. Interns can work full- or part-time. Deadlines for applying are March 15 (summer), August 1 (fall), October 14 (spring) and November 1 (winter term).

Editorial interns' main responsibility is fact-checking, perhaps the least glamorous aspect of our business but an integral part of our process. They work on all of our editorial products, including Indianapolis Monthly Home, Indy Shops, City Guide, Menu Guide, regular edit for Indianapolis Monthly, and special sections for Indianapolis Monthly. They also do research for the staff on a variety of topics. The editorial staff often assigns short pieces to be written by interns, and we strive to ensure that each intern gets at least one byline in at least one of our products. Interns are expected to participate in meetings and to submit story ideas. They need to be extremely detail-oriented, willing to ask questions, and able to multitask.
